What does water removal and drying cost per square foot?
The source lists per square foot figures you can use to scale repairs. It reports an average cost per square foot of $15 to $17 for cleanup.
For initial water removal specifically, the page lists a lower range of about $4 to $8 per square foot depending on the size of the area and the category of flood water. Use the $4 to $8 number for straight extraction jobs and the $15 to $17 number for a more complete cleanup and drying package.
How much for repairs to walls, floors, and mold remediation?
If walls or finishes need repair, the site gives a repair range of about $100 to $300 for flood damaged walls. That is a rough repair-only estimate for replacing or patching wall sections.
Mold can follow floods and the source lists mold remediation estimates ranging from as low as $500 to as high as $10,000 depending on how much is infested and whether structural work is required. Mold pricing varies widely so get an inspection as soon as the water is out.

What affects the final price and what should I do first?
Key price drivers are the category of water, the area affected, and how quickly you get professional help. Category 1 water from a clean source is the least expensive to fix. Category 2 and 3 water that carries contaminants or sewage raises cost and scope because of safety and disposal requirements.

Does homeowners insurance cover flood restoration in Aberdeen?
Typical homeowners insurance does not cover flood damage from outside water like heavy storms or river overflow. Flood insurance covers that type of loss. The source says homeowners policies may cover some internal water events such as burst pipes, but check your policy and contact your agent.
Can restoration companies bill my insurance directly?
Yes. The page notes many restoration companies will bill your insurer directly. You may still be responsible for deductibles and any work your insurer does not cover.
